As I was reading the Erin In The Morning newsletter, it reminded me of The Green Book by Victor Green.

The Green Book, aka the “Negro Motorist Green Book”, was a guide created in 1936 to help black travelers. It listed safe resources to keep them from running into difficulties while traveling.

Because of the horrible anti-trans bills republicans are passing in various states, Erin provides a list of the safest to the most dangerous states based on anti-trans legislation. Erin also has color-coded maps she updates regularly in her newsletter site.

Here are the states that are the Most Protective States and The Worst States as of today, Monday, 4/17/2023. For other lists and maps that show Low-Risk States, Moderate Risk States, and High-Risk States, visit Erin’s newsletter.

Most Protective States:
  • California
  • Colorado
  • Connecticut
  • Hawaii
  • Illinois
  • Maryland
  • Massachusetts
  • Minnesota
  • New Mexico
  • New York
  • Oregon
  • Vermont
  • Washington
  • Washington, D.C.
The Worst States:
  • Alabama
  • Arkansas
  • Florida
  • Georgia
  • Idaho
  • Indiana
  • Iowa
  • Kentucky
  • Louisiana
  • Missouri
  • Mississippi
  • Oklahoma
  • South Dakota
  • Tennessee
  • Texas
  • Utah
